This Year's Model Updates:

The 2007 Veracruz is Hyundai's latest trip uptown. Slotting above the Santa Fe in terms of price and size, this midsize crossover SUV offers a 260-horsepower V6, luxury features galore and a roomy, well-trimmed cabin.

Pros:
  • Excellent build and materials quality, long warranty, generous standard features list for price, standard third-row seating.
Cons:
  • Bland styling up front, navigation system not available.

  • Deadly Defect !!!! - 2007 Hyundai Veracruz
    By -

    With 826 miles on the vehicle I was coming up to a stop sign, heard a pop in the steering column and lost all steering on the vehicle. You could spin the steering wheel completely around. Coasted to a stop, had it towed to the nearest Hyundai dealer. They found it was an assembly line defect in putting the steering column together. They were very sorry it happened, but insured me they had never seen this before. They acted like my radio knob had fallen off. If I had been going down the highway at 60 mph I wouldnt be writing this now. If you have a Veracruz I would recommend you have your steering column checked. If it happened once it can happen again!
